Church World Service Indonesia is an international non-governmental
organization working in relief, development, and refugee assistance in
various locations in Indonesia. CWS is searching for a Community Based
Activity Program Officer, PO HIV/AIDS, Data Entry Clerk - Registration Unit
(3 positions) and Field Officer (2 positions) for our Jakarta Office or
Cipayung Refugee Centre. We offer a friendly working environment with a
commitment to ensure diversity and gender equity within our organization.
